Pertinent technical details or techniques:
Canon 80d with Macro twinlight. Sigma 150mm Macro f 13 1/125sec. I hand held one of the twinlights underneath the orchid petal to give an underglow. my sensor is apparently really dirty so you may see some clone spots. single image handheld.
